From 410403c0764f3d092cf1b53b6a377dbebbc997b4 Mon Sep 17 00:00:00 2001 From: Ryan Boren Date: Wed, 2 Jul 2008 22:56:57 +0000 Subject: [PATCH] Unlink temporary file if sideload fails. see #7220 git-svn-id: https://develop.svn.wordpress.org/trunk@8241 602fd350-edb4-49c9-b593-d223f7449a82 --- wp-admin/includes/media.php | 4 +--- 1 file changed, 1 insertion(+), 3 deletions(-) diff --git a/wp-admin/includes/media.php b/wp-admin/includes/media.php index 80910d6c24..c44864c852 100644 --- a/wp-admin/includes/media.php +++ b/wp-admin/includes/media.php @@ -340,10 +340,8 @@ function media_sideload_image($file, $post_id, $desc = null) { $id = media_handle_sideload($file_array, $post_id, $desc); $src = $id; - unset($file_array); - if ( is_wp_error($id) ) { - $errors['upload_error'] = $id; + @unlink($file_array['tmp_name']); return $id; } }